Pro Volleyball Federation (www.provolleyball.com) is REAL pro volleyball and the premier women’s professional volleyball league in North America. They’ll begin play in February 2024 with world class players and coaches, including some of America’s greatest volleyball players and elite players from around the world.  

Dallas is the home of the newest franchise in the league! The team was acquired by a Dallas-based investment group led by Wall Street veteran and Mandalorian Capital founder Armand Sadoughi and other Dallas business community leaders, including noted local business lawyers Evan D. Stone and Michel Benitez, Mubina Benitez and Richard Zaleskie. 

Dallas becomes the first announced team that will begin play in the 2025 Pro Volleyball Federation season. Pro Volleyball Federation’s inaugural season will launch in February 2024 with seven teams stretching from coast to coast. The league is expected to announce additional 2025 teams in the coming days.

Dallas also becomes the second publicly announced Pro Volleyball Federation team in a top 10 U.S. media market, joining the league’s Atlanta franchise. Pro Volleyball Federation will launch real pro volleyball in February 2024 with announced teams in Atlanta, Orlando, San Diego, Columbus (OH), Grand Rapids (MI), and Omaha. The Dallas team will take the floor in 2025 – Pro Volleyball Federation’s second season and following the 2024 Olympic Games – giving it runway to build a franchise fitting for one of the premier volleyball markets in the United States.

Recently named the country’s Best City for Sports Business by Sports Business Journal and consistently ranking among the top cities in the United States for sports fans, Dallas has proven to be one of America’s true sports hubs, filled with passionate and loyal fans of their favorite pro teams.  

“Dallas has a proud and storied history with volleyball, and we celebrate that legacy with the addition of a Pro Volleyball Federation franchise,” said Monica Paul, Executive Director of the Dallas Sports Commission. “Volleyball is a staple in our community, as we annually host the Lone Star Classic National Qualifier, have hosted USA Volleyball Championships, and serve as home to more than 14,000 USAV members. We look forward to showcasing our region’s passion for the sport as we welcome the Dallas Pro Volleyball Federation team in 2025.” 

The new Dallas team will soon be making announcements related to its name and logo, executive staff, coaching staff, and playing venue.
